PURPOSE OF THIS STEP:
You need to register with Grants.gov to obtain an account to submit applications and track the status of submitted applications.

HOW LONG SHOULD IT TAKE?
Same Day. You will be registered when you submit your information.

HOW DO I REGISTER WITH GRANTS.GOV?
Once you have received your username and password from Operational Research Consultants (ORC), Grants.gov’s credential provider, you will need to register with Grants.gov to complete the individual registration process.

Enter the username and password that you created during the ORC registration process. You will then be asked to provide your first and last name, phone number, email address and title. A default number will be pre-populated in the Data Universal Number System (DUNS) Number field. Once you finish and save the information at Grants.gov, you can use your username and password to submit applications at Grants.gov.

You are now ready to apply for individual grant opportunities!

Please be aware that you will ONLY be able to submit applications that are open to individuals. You will not be able to submit applications with your username and password to funding opportunities where organizations are the only eligible applicants.
